Media & news

Local news in English

There is no printed newspaper in English in Sweden, but a really good and professionally made e-zine called The Local providing daily local news in English.

Newspapers and magazines

"PressbyrÄn" operates a chain of small stores and news stands, selling some international newspapers and magazines. The one with the largest assortment is found in the Central Station.

Book stores

Most large bookstores sell books in English, some also in French, Spanish and Italian.

Radio

The major broadcasting company in Sweden is Sveriges Radio who provides public service broadcasting through the channelsP1, P2, P3, P4 and some local stations. Every town has its own commercial radio stations of which many are owned by international broadcasting companies. The most well known are; Golden Hits FM 100,8Radio Rixand Classic FM.

Television

In Sweden there are cables in most places providing a variety of television channels. In places without cable you have access to the public service channels TV1 and TV2 (public service) as well as commercial TV4. Better hotels will offer their guests CNN and/or BBC International.

The following are Swedish commercial channels; TV4 TV3 Kanal 5, ZTV, TV6 and TV 8.
